Minnesota James Beard award winning authors and chefs Amy Thielen and Hank Shaw talk about the new cookbook "Borderlands: Recipes and Stories from the Rio Grande to the Pacific."

In this conversation from the KAXE Morning Show Hank Shaw joined us to talk about his new cookbook, Borderlands: Recipes and Stories from the Rio Grande to the Pacific.

Hank Shaw is a James Beard award winning cookbook author and chef. His website is Hunter Angler Gardener Cook.

Borderlands is described as a creative culinary road map exploring recipes like Fish Tacos, Chimichangas and Cactus Salad as well wild food recipes and techniques of using ingredients like mesquite, wild game and wild greens.

In this conversation you'll hear talk of butter, mincemeat pie with venison and blueberries and cuisine bringing together cultures.

"The whole beginning of the book is based on sort of basics and bedrock stuff like making means and learning how to make those beans into refried beans," said Shaw, "those are your building blocks.
